Wipro bags $1 billion contract from Olam Group, in which Temasek Holding has majority stake

Wipro would deploy its capabilities throughout Olam Group’s ‘farm-to-fork’ worth chain, delivering industry-specific options that align with the Group’s enterprise priorities. File

Wipro Ltd. on Monday (April 6, 2026) mentioned it bagged an 8-year contract price $1 billion from Olam Group, a Singapore-based meals and agri‑enterprise agency in which state-owned funding agency Temasek Holdings has a majority stake.

Wipro mentioned as a part of the contract it could purchase Olam Group’s IT and digital companies enterprise, Mindsprint, for $375 million, an all-cash deal. Mindsprint would change into a completely owned subsidiary of Wipro, topic to regulatory approvals and shutting circumstances. The acquisition course of is predicted to shut by the tip of Q1 FY27.
